Papua New Guinea - Primary income payments (BoP, current US$)
The latest value for Primary income payments (BoP, current US$) in Papua New Guinea was $647,917,700 as of 2018. Over the past 42 years, the value for this indicator has fluctuated between $875,546,800 in 2006 and $75,178,340 in 1976.
Definition: Primary income payments refer to employee compensation paid to nonresident workers and investment income (payments on direct investment, portfolio investment, other investments). Data are in current U.S. dollars.
Source: International Monetary Fund, Balance of Payments Statistics Yearbook and data files.
